ADO+D5+MS Access Application Deployment using InstallSheld Express

Does anyone know what is the correct procedure to deploy Delphi application
written for Access backend and using ADO components?
I have InstallShield express that came with D5 but I can't find anything
relevant there.
I have downloaded MDAC 2.5 from MS site but I would prefer installing
everything using a single installation script.
